MCT (Minimal Context Thread system)
WCOS (Web Cache Object Storage)
The JAGUAR's innovative kernel engine is based on MCT, which creates a thread system that performs like a well-crafted
asynchronous system enabling faster context switching and scheduling. MCT is already capable of handling a million sessions
efficiently leading to significant improvements in performance. In addition, MCT speeds up processing by creating only one
thread for the one CPU core, and guarantees improved scalable performance for a number of CPU cores.
JAGUAR has an exclusive file system especially designed for web caching. It can solve disk bottlenecks by allowing parallel disk
access and parallel processing. This file system improves the performance of the data and maximizes the RAM usage. In addition,
it improves the transaction time of Disk IO / Memory IO by accelerating the throughput processing of web requests.

64-bit Engine/72GB MemoryThe JAGUAR 5000 supports a 64-bit operating kernel, which can utilize up to 72GB of memory.
The larger the memory, the more objects can be cached. This leads to improved throughput and
dramatically reduces response time. This high capacity directly affects the disk capacity for cache
servers. As a result, a relatively small number of JAGUAR 5000 servers can replace a larger number
of web server clusters.
Connection ManagementThe JAGUAR product has a highly effective connection management system due to its superior
specifications and the MCT technology. The JAGUAR uses the persistent connection of the HTTP 1.1
to both clients and original servers. Connections with original servers are minimized and efficiently
utilized resulting in optimal workload of the original web server.
Capacity
Terabytes DiskAs data centers grow and the traffic of large scale portals and shopping malls increase, large
caching storage will be required. In addition, the popularity of multimedia sites creates additional
performance latencies and bottlenecking due to the large multimedia files being accessed and
transferred. The JAGUAR 5000 solves these problems by utilizing WCOS technology and allowing
multimedia content to be processed and cached efficiently in terabyte disks.
A Million of Concurrent ConnectionsThe JAGUAR 5000 can support sudden surges of over a million concurrent connections caused by
extraordinary events. At the same time the JAGUAR 5000 can protect web servers from SYN attack/
denial of service (DoS) by acting as a large buffer.

Web Object ManagementObject splitting - In the event of un-cached content being requested simultaneously by users, the
JAGUAR builds based on the requested service with only partially cached objects.
This provides stable service and prevents long delays.
Various Rules for Refreshing Object - The JAGUAR provides the ability to configure object refresh
time, TTL, for requested contents. To avoid over loading a server from frequent validation checks,
the JAGUAR is able to configure longer periods in the event the object does not change after
validation check. In addition, it supports wild cards and regular expressions.
Web Cache ConfigurationConfiguring Cache Parameters - The JAGUAR optimizes the caching performance by properly
adjusting the cache parameters such as max header size, average object size, max stored object
number, and max client sessions.
Virtual Reverse Host - This feature provides the list of reverse hosts by classifying user requests.
Classification can be done by using the hostname of the HTTP request and can also be done by using
the IP address and port number of the JAGUAR 5000. Within the list of the reverse hosts, various
load balancing mechanisms, such as round-robin, URL-hash, directory, etc., are supported.
Caching Policy - Some contents can be configured to cache by matching specific conditions of the
origin server. By filtering headers and cookie headers of dedicated URL patterns, modification of the
site can be reduced.

Security Traffic Acceleration (SSL Acceleration) - Secure web content on HTTPS cannot be
cached in conventional manners. Content must be encrypted and requires SSL acceleration.
The JAGUAR 5000 supports safe and rapid content caching on HTTPS. This product is tailored
towards high security content providers such as financial institutions who provide web solutions to
their end customers.
